We are all set to begin then as the umpires step out to the middle. The Delhi players, after completing their quick little huddle, take their positions on the field. Following them are Bangalore's openers, Devdutt Padikkal and Josh Philippe. Daniel Sams to begin with the ball for Delhi. LET'S PLAY...
Bangalore (Playing XI) - Devdutt Padikkal, Josh Philippe (WK), Virat Kohli (C), AB de Villiers, Shivam Dube (IN FOR GURKEERAT SINGH MANN), Shahbaz Ahmed (IN FOR NAVDEEP SAINI), Chris Morris, Washington Sundar, Isuru Udana, Mohammed Siraj, Yuzvendra Chahal.
Delhi (Playing XI) - Prithvi Shaw, Shikhar Dhawan, Shreyas Iyer (C), Rishabh Pant (WK), Daniel Sams (IN FOR SHIMRON HETMYER), Marcus Stoinis, Ajinkya Rahane (IN FOR HARSHAL PATEL), Kagiso Rabada, Ravichandran Ashwin, Axar Patel (IN FOR PRAVIN DUBEY), Anrich Nortje.
Shreyas Iyer, the Delhi skipper, says that dew is going to play a massive role. Feels that having the total in front of them is always a good option. With the run rate being a factor, it will be good for them. Tells that Rahane, Axar and Sams are the three changes for them.
Virat Kohli, Bangalore's captain, says that on the changes, Dube replaces Mann and Shahbaz Ahmed replaces Saini. On the preparation, Virat says that one should try and win every game. States that he would have loved to bowl first as well. States that in the earlier situations too, it was about winning the game and moving ahead. Adds honestly that if one does not play well, there is no point in relying on how others play and depending on those results in your favour.
